SBU counter-intelligence apprehended a GRU agent in Odesa who posed as a volunteer rescuer to gather intelligence on Russian air attack consequences and locate HIMARS and air defense system positions.

Odesa, Odesa Oblast

The agent, a 29-year-old Odesa resident and former member of the Leninist Communist Youth Union, joined volunteer rescuer ranks to document Russian attack consequences and relay intelligence to GRU for planning new attacks.

The agent attempted to identify positions of HIMARS and air defense systems belonging to the Armed Forces of Ukraine along the frontline in Odesa region.

The individual was notified of suspicion under Part 2 of Article 111 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ine and could face life imprisonment.
